The e-commerce and dual product quality are in the focus of this year’s consumer protection
The regulation of e-commerce and eliminate the double product quality are in the focus of this year’s consumer protection, but the monitoring of the product demonstrations remains a priority as well – Kara Ákos, Minister of State of the Ministry of National Development (NFM) told on Tuesday in Budapest at a press conference.
The Minister of State called for consumer protection guarantees to regulate the explosively growing Internet commerce, also called the current actions effective. The online businesses are cooperative, the authorities continue to coordinate with them – he added. (MTI)
